The Bridge Between Knowledge and Mastery
The transition from a student to an expert practitioner requires more than just years of experience; it requires structured mentorship and advanced clinical reasoning. This is where specialized training becomes invaluable. Unlike short-term workshops that focus on a single technique, a comprehensive program immerses the therapist in the "why" behind every intervention.
Clinicians learn to analyze complex cases through a multi-dimensional lens. For instance, a persistent shoulder issue might not be a local muscle tear but a systemic dysfunction involving the cervical spine and rib cage mechanics. By refining these diagnostic skills, therapists can avoid the trial-and-error approach, leading to significantly better patient outcomes and shorter recovery timelines.

Accessibility and the Hybrid Learning Model
Accessibility has improved dramatically over the last few years. Many premier institutes now offer hybrid formats, where theoretical modules are delivered through high-fidelity digital platforms, followed by intensive, on-site clinical residencies. This allows working professionals to maintain their practice while simultaneously upgrading their credentials.
